What the numbers mean

A plugin’s position is based on its standing in the WordPress.org “Popular” listing, which is driven largely by active installs and recent download velocity. Active installs (shown in buckets like 10M+ or 500K+) count sites currently running the plugin — and the directory caps the public figure at 10M+, a bucket only a handful of plugins occupy. As of 2026-08-07 that top tier is held by Elementor, Yoast SEO, and Contact Form 7.

Downloads behave differently for plugins than for themes. Every new release pushes an update to the plugin’s entire install base, so daily downloads spike with each version shipped — a plugin can post millions of downloads in a week without gaining a single new user. And as with default themes, bundling matters: Akismet ships with WordPress core, so part of its install base reflects preinstallation rather than deliberate choice.

Reading the movement columns

The 1D, 7D, and 30D columns show how far a plugin has climbed or dropped over each window. Large short-term jumps — the biggest risers — usually follow a directory feature, a major release, security headlines, or a change in WordPress core itself: Classic Editor’s years-long run near the top began as a direct reaction to the block editor’s launch. Sharp falls more often mean a competitor surged than a plugin actually losing installs. Entries in New in range are plugins that broke into the tracked ranking for the first time that week.

Directory popularity vs. real-world importance

Directory rank and real-world importance aren’t the same thing. The “Popular” sort rewards download velocity, which favors plugins that update often and plugins bundled with hosting stacks. Meanwhile a plugin like WooCommerce anchors a huge share of all online stores, and entire ecosystems — page-builder add-ons, form extensions, payment gateways — ride on the adoption of the platforms they extend. What’s the difference between active installs and downloads?

Active installs count the sites currently running a plugin, shown in ranges like 10M+ or 500K+. Downloads count every fresh install and every update — so for a widely installed plugin, a new release alone can generate millions of downloads in days. That’s why a plugin can top the download charts while its active-install base stays flat, and why both columns are worth watching.

How is WordPress plugin popularity measured?

Directory popularity comes from the WordPress.org “Popular” listing, driven mainly by active installs and download velocity. It rewards momentum: plugins that update frequently or ship with WordPress itself rank higher than raw usage alone would suggest.
